Organizational Setting and Reporting Relationship

The position of Financial Management Specialist is assigned to the Financial Management Division (PFFM) within the Procurement, Portfolio and Financial Management Department (PPFD). You will be outposted to Papua New Guinea Resident Mission (PNRM) in Port Moresby, Papua New Guinea for an initial assignment of three years. After this period, subject to business needs, the role may be assigned at our Headquarters in Manila, Philippines or at another resident mission office. Relocation is required. All reasonable relocation expenses will be covered.

You will report to the Director, PFFM, and the Country Director, PNRM, and will oversee junior team members and consultants.

Your Role

As a Financial Management Specialist, you will support technical advisory, knowledge sharing, and capacity building activities to strengthen project financial management and financial due diligence (FDD), ensuring high-quality outcomes across ADB. Your work will include other developing member countries (DMCs) in the region.

You will:

  • Provide technical guidance, analysis, and advice on financial management and financial due diligence issues in sovereign operations, following relevant ADB policies, instructions, guidelines and procedures.
  • Help develop financial management guidelines, procedures, and internal review processes for Audited Project Financial Statements and Audited Entity Financial Statements (APFS/AEFS). This support will also promote automation and ADB's digitalization agenda.
  • Conduct financial due diligence for sovereign operations, including assessments of accomplishing and implementing agencies, financing plans, financial viability, financial covenants, risk mitigation measures, and financial reporting, auditing, and disclosure arrangements.
  • Provide financial management throughout project processing, implementation and technical assistance to facilitate project implementation, add value and help ensure financial sustainability, better financial management practices, and adherence to international accounting and auditing standards.
  • Review APFS/AEFS for sovereign projects, validate implementation of audit recommendations, and ensure quality control of financial management inputs in operational documents, reports, briefings, and presentations.
  • Deliver financial management capacity building and knowledge-sharing programs for clients and staff, while promoting partnerships with partners and participating in relevant professional forums.
  • Manage staff and consultant performance and support ongoing learning and development.

Qualifications

You will need:

  • University degree in business, finance, commerce, or related fields; preferably at post-graduate level or its equivalent.
  • Professional qualification in accounting (e.g., CPA, CA, ACCA) from an internationally recognized institution (e.g., IFAC).
  • At least 6 years of relevant professional experience in private or public sector financial management or related area with international experience working in several countries.
  • Demonstrated experience leading projects and sharing relevant knowledge to benefit the broader ADB community.
  • Written and verbal proficiency in English.
  • Experience mentoring team members, providing guidance on delivery of services.

Additional Information

This appointment is open to internal and external applicants.

This is a fixed term appointment with option to renew, initially for a period of up to 3 years, or up to the Normal Retirement Date (NRD), whichever comes earlier, for the purpose(s) and conditions determined by ADB, in accordance with Administrative Order No. 2.01 (Recruitment and Appointment). After the initial fixed-term period, ADB may choose to renew the appointment for up to an additional 3 years or not renewed. This decision will be made in the overall interest of ADB, based on factors including but not limited to the requirement of Staff's particular blend of skills and experience for the medium-term work program of the organizational unit, sufficient funding to cover the renewed period, and Staff's performance and suitability for employment. There is no limit to the number of renewals up to NRD. However, this appointment is not convertible to a regular appointment.

About Us

ADB is a leading multilateral development bank supporting inclusive, resilient, and sustainable growth across Asia and the Pacific. Working with its members and partners to solve complex challenges together, ADB harnesses innovative financial tools and strategic partnerships to transform lives, build quality infrastructure, and safeguard our planet. Founded in 1966, ADB is headquartered in Manila and owned by 69 members—50 from the region.

ADB only hires nationals of its 69 members.
